What is the Ideal pH Range for Growing Loblolly Pine Seedlings?

The ideal pH range for growing loblolly pine seedlings in a bareroot nursery varies slightly depending on the source. According to one school of thought, the optimal pH range is between 5.5 and 6.5, which is based on nutrient availability charts. However, another school suggests that loblolly pine seedlings grow best in “very strong acid” soils with a pH range of 4.5 to 5.0, based on research from nursery trials. This lower pH range is supported by studies that show better growth and health in seedlings grown in acidic soils.

How Does Pine Sap Impact the Surrounding Flora?

Pine sap, also known as pine resin, is a sticky, viscous liquid produced by pine trees. It primarily consists of terpenes, which are organic compounds responsible for the tree’s defense against insects and diseases. The chemical composition of pine sap includes:

  • Terpenes: These are the main components of pine sap, accounting for its sticky and aromatic properties. Terpenes can inhibit the growth of certain microorganisms and may affect the growth of other plants in close proximity.
  • Resin acids: These are a type of terpene that contributes to the sap’s acidity and stickiness. Resin acids can also influence the growth of surrounding flora by altering soil pH and nutrient availability.

The acidity of pine sap can impact the growth of other plants within the nursery by:

  1. Altering soil pH: The acidic nature of pine sap can lower the soil pH, which may affect the availability of nutrients for other plants. This can be beneficial for acid-loving plants but may hinder the growth of plants that prefer more neutral or alkaline soils.
  2. Inhibiting microbial growth: The terpenes in pine sap can inhibit the growth of certain microorganisms, which can affect the decomposition process and nutrient cycling in the soil. This may impact the growth of other plants that rely on these microorganisms for nutrient uptake.

What are the Recommended Practices for Managing Soil pH and Nutrient Availability?

To manage soil pH and nutrient availability in a loblolly pine nursery, the following practices are recommended:

Soil Testing

Regular soil testing is crucial to determine the pH and nutrient levels. This should be done at least every 2-3 months during the growing season to ensure optimal conditions.

pH Adjustments

Based on soil test results, pH adjustments can be made by adding lime to raise the pH or elemental sulfur to lower it. The application rates will depend on the specific soil type and the desired pH range.

Fertilization

Fertilizers should be applied based on soil test results to ensure adequate nutrient availability. A balanced fertilizer with a slightly acidic pH (around 5.5-6.5) is recommended for loblolly pine seedlings.

Mulching

Mulching around the seedlings can help retain moisture, suppress weeds, and regulate soil temperature. Organic mulches like pine straw or wood chips are suitable for loblolly pine nurseries.

Irrigation

Proper irrigation is essential to maintain optimal soil moisture. Watering should be done regularly, especially during hot and dry weather conditions.
